Maps
People
Photos
Talk
My Stuff
Saint-Jean Cathedral inside
This Freakin' Rocks!!!
posted by
wangyng
from
Lyon
,
France
from the travel blog:
Hello Europe!!
tagged
France
and
Lyon
comment on this...